King Ranch Chicken Casserole Recipe

Ingredients:

1 cup Onions -- diced
1 cup Green Bell Peppers -- diced
1/2 pound Mushrooms
1/8 cup Butter or Margarine
1 can Cream of Mushroom soup, condensed
1 can Cream of Chicken soup, condensed
1 pound Cheddar Cheese -- shredded
2 cups Chicken, white meat -- cooked and diced
1 can Tomatoes -- with Green Chilis
1 clove Garlic -- minced
2 tablespoon Chili Powder
1 tablespoon Chicken Broth
12 large Corn Tortillas -- torn into quarters

Directions:

In a large pan, saute onion, bell pepper, and mushrooms in butter,
Add soups, tomatoes & chilies, garlic, chili powder, and chicken broth.
Line bottom of a 9x13 inch pan with pieces of tortillas. Spread half the chicken over the tortillas and top with half of the sauce, then half of the cheese.
Cover with another layer of torn corn tortillas, and repeat the chicken, sauce and cheese layers. Bake at 350º for 30 minutes or until bubbly.
